The cover, penciled by Alan Weiss and inked by Frank Giacoia, packs the scene with a ragtag boys' brigade crouching behind cover and trading fire with the Red Vest Gang while horses and smoke fill the background. The tagline "Can a Boys' Brigade Defeat the Red Vest Gang?" makes this issue of "The Calibre City Kids!" one lively chapter in the Outlaw Kid's frontier adventures.
